Output a95de3c7e53e1d60108c68914eba28081dadd33250b9023abb2d7f039845d6ac:0

value
3469978099
script pubkey
OP_0 OP_PUSHBYTES_20 4abb18126ed6501cba386c6594e84f410ba569d8
address
tb1qf2a3synw6egpew3cd3jef6z0gy9626wc36e32a
transaction
a95de3c7e53e1d60108c68914eba28081dadd33250b9023abb2d7f039845d6ac
confirmations
215709
spent
true